Range and Efficiency

Even though the Zeekr X Privilege AWD (2023-…) has a larger battery, the Volvo EX30 Single Motor Extended Range (2023-…) higher energy efficiency results in a longer real-world driving range.

Property Zeekr X Privilege AWD Volvo EX30 Single Motor Extended Range
Range (EPA) - Range (EPA) 420 km
Range (WLTP) 425 km 480 km
Range (GCC) 361 km 404 km
Battery Capacity (Nominal) 69 kWh 69 kWh
Battery Capacity (Usable) 65 kWh 64 kWh
Efficiency per 100 km 18 kWh/100 km 15.8 kWh/100 km
Efficiency per kWh 5.55 km/kWh 6.31 km/kWh
Range and Efficiency Score 6.3 7.6

Charging

Both vehicles utilize a standard 400-volt architecture.

The Volvo EX30 Single Motor Extended Range (2023-…) offers faster charging speeds at DC stations, reaching up to 175 kW, while the Zeekr X Privilege AWD (2023-…) maxes out at 158 kW.

The Zeekr X Privilege AWD (2023-…) features a more powerful on-board charger, supporting a maximum AC charging power of 22 kW, whereas the Volvo EX30 Single Motor Extended Range (2023-…) is limited to 11 kW.

Property Zeekr X Privilege AWD Volvo EX30 Single Motor Extended Range
Max Charging Power (AC) 22 kW 11 kW
Max Charging Power (DC) 158 kW 175 kW
Architecture 400 V 400 V
Charge Port CCS Type 2 CCS Type 2
Charging Score 7.6 6.3

Performance

The Volvo EX30 Single Motor Extended Range (2023-…) is rear-wheel drive, while the Zeekr X Privilege AWD (2023-…) offers an all-wheel drive system.

The Zeekr X Privilege AWD (2023-…) boasts greater motor power and accelerates faster from 0 to 100 km/h.

Property Zeekr X Privilege AWD Volvo EX30 Single Motor Extended Range
Drive Type AWD RWD
Motor Type PMSM (front), PMSM (rear) PMSM
Motor Power (kW) 315 kW 200 kW
Motor Power (hp) 422 hp 268 hp
Motor Torque 543 Nm 343 Nm
0-100 km/h 3.8 s 5.3 s
Top Speed 190 km/h 180 km/h
Performance Score 5.6 4.4

Cargo and Towing

The Zeekr X Privilege AWD (2023-…) provides more cargo capacity, featuring both a larger trunk and more space with the rear seats folded.

Both models feature a convenient frunk (front trunk), providing additional storage space.

When it comes to towing, both cars offer identical towing capacity (up to 1600 kg).

Property Zeekr X Privilege AWD Volvo EX30 Single Motor Extended Range
Number of Seats 5 5
Curb Weight 2035 kg 1850 kg
Cargo Volume (Trunk) 362 l 318 l
Cargo Volume (Max) 1182 l 843 l
Cargo Volume (Frunk) 21 l 7 l
Towing Capacity 1600 kg 1600 kg
Cargo and Towing Score 6.3 5.9
